Propolis Supplement in China Trends and Forecast
The future of the propolis supplement market in China looks promising with opportunities in the online sale and offline sale markets. The global propolis supplement market is expected to grow with a CAGR of 5.2% from 2025 to 2031. The propolis supplement market in China is also forecasted to witness strong growth over the forecast period. The major drivers for this market are the rising demand for natural remedies, the growing awareness of health benefits, and the increase in propolis-based products.
• Lucintel forecasts that, within the type category, propolis capsule is expected to witness the highest growth over the forecast period.
• Within the application category, online sale is expected to witness higher growth.

The challenges in the propolis supplement market in China are:
• Regulatory Complexities: Navigating China’s regulatory landscape can be complex due to evolving standards and approval processes for dietary supplements. Manufacturers often face lengthy approval times, strict labeling requirements, and quality control standards, which can delay product launches and increase costs. Non-compliance risks include product recalls and legal penalties, discouraging innovation and market entry for smaller players. Additionally, inconsistent enforcement across regions can create uncertainties, making it difficult for companies to plan long-term strategies and maintain compliance.
• Supply Chain and Quality Control Issues: The availability and quality of raw propolis are critical for producing effective supplements. Fluctuations in raw material supply, driven by environmental factors and bee health, can impact production continuity. Ensuring consistent quality and purity is challenging due to contamination risks and variability in raw material sources. These issues can lead to product recalls, damage brand reputation, and increase manufacturing costs. Strengthening supply chain resilience and establishing quality standards are essential but require significant investment and expertise.
• Consumer Awareness and Education Gaps: Despite rising interest, many consumers lack comprehensive knowledge about propolis benefits, proper usage, and safety considerations. This knowledge gap can lead to misconceptions, misuse, or skepticism, hindering market growth. Educating consumers requires targeted marketing, scientific validation, and transparent communication, which can be resource-intensive. Without adequate awareness, potential customers may prefer familiar or traditional remedies over newer supplement options, limiting market penetration and growth opportunities.
